tort:小对象运行时间

时间:2024-06-24 01:23:33
【文件属性】:

文件名称:tort:小对象运行时间

文件大小:292KB

文件格式:ZIP

更新时间:2024-06-24 01:23:33

C

tort - 小对象运行时 受到 Ian Piumarta 的 idst、maru 和其他小型运行时的启发。 核心是大约。 5000 行 C. 支持: 原始对象类型。 细绳。 象征。 方法。 方法表。 标记的整数。 向量。 一对。 地图。 带有 FILE* 的 IO 和完成。 动态消息分发。 使用全局方法缓存在 OS X 64 位上每秒发送约 25,000,000 次。 全局方法缓存监视由于以下原因导致的失效: 使用符号版本计数器的新方法定义。 lookup() 元发送协议方法的变化。 方法表委托的变化。 元发送协议: 分解为lookup(message, receiver, ...), apply(message, receiver, ...)。 完全递归的 lookup() 委托。 在 C 堆栈上分配的消息对象。 支持尾递归。 支持非符号


网友评论